In Gears 5 Horde mode, characters have ultimates

And you can play as Jack.

The Coalition has revealed Gears 5's Horde mode.

Perhaps the headline change to Gears' famous five-player co-op defense mode is the addition of ultimates for the various characters.

JD calls in an airstrike, for example. Fahz's X-Ray ultimate lets him see through walls. Kait can turn invisible. You can also play as Jack, Gears' famous helpful bot. Jack flies across the stage, offering support and dishing out area of effect attacks. Its ultimate, called Hi-Jack, lets him control an enemy.

Gears 5 Horde is more aggressive, in the sense you'll want to capture "power taps", which help you grow your power. The idea here is you and your friends shouldn't just camp in one area for 50 waves. To go far you'll want to expand your base to capture taps.

Gears 5 comes out 6th September on Xbox One and PC, including Steam.
